The Three Eras of Personal Knowledge Management

Over the past two decades, Personal Knowledge Management has moved through distinct phases.

What began as a simple effort to digitize notes evolved into systems that connected ideas into networks, and now, with the rise of artificial intelligence, has reached a stage where our tools actively collaborate with us. 

Let’s take a look at each stage in more detail:

Era 1: The Digital Filing Cabinet (Storage)

The first era of Personal Knowledge Management began with digital storage software. Tools like Evernote and OneNote offered a simple promise: capture everything and store it in one place. 

For the ambitious professional, this was liberating. Suddenly, notes, articles, and documents could be kept neatly in the cloud, accessible across devices, and tagged for future reference. 

But while this solved the problem of storage, it introduced a new challenge: retrieval. 

These systems worked like archives that are efficient for depositing information, but less effective when it came to pulling meaning out of the mass.

Professionals often found themselves spending more time searching through their collections than actually using them.

The digital filing cabinet was a step forward, but it left knowledge largely static, waiting to be rediscovered.

Era 2: The Networked Brain (Connection)

The second era transformed the future of PKM from a collection of isolated files into a living web of interconnected ideas

Tools such as Roam Research, Obsidian, and Notion shifted the focus from storage to connection.

By linking notes together, professionals could create a “networked brain,” where knowledge became discoverable and relationships between ideas emerged more organically. 

This was a breakthrough in how we thought about personal information.

Instead of searching for a single note, users could explore an entire web of associations, often stumbling upon insights they might not have anticipated. 

Yet, despite its elegance, this approach still required constant manual effort.

The system only worked as well as the user’s discipline in creating links, maintaining structure, and curating their knowledge. 

In practice, the networked brain expanded possibilities but still kept professionals firmly in the role of system managers.

Real Benefits of AI-Powered Personal Knowledge Management

One of the most immediate benefits of AI-enhanced Personal Knowledge Management is the shift from keyword search to semantic search notes.

Instead of digging through folders or trying to remember exact phrases, professionals can now find information based on meaning. 

Ask a question in your own words, and the system retrieves the most relevant ideas, notes, and sources, even if you didn’t tag or label them precisely.

This alone saves countless hours and eliminates the frustration of hunting for knowledge you know you captured but cannot locate.

Another powerful advantage is AI-summarization tools. Whether it’s a lengthy report, a dense academic article, or meeting notes, AI can distill the essential points in seconds.

You no longer need to sift through every detail to understand the core message, they can absorb key insights quickly and decide where to dig deeper. Over time, this allows for faster learning and more informed decision-making.

AI also transforms the way connections between ideas are discovered. In traditional PKM systems, linking notes required deliberate effort.

With AI, the system recognizes patterns and relationships on its own, surfacing insights that might otherwise remain hidden. 

Imagine drafting a new strategy document and being reminded of a concept from a book you read months ago, or a note from a past project that suddenly becomes relevant.

These intelligent links don’t just organize your information; they expand your thinking.
